How much do fraud man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for fraud manager in Fishers, IN is $95,558.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$62,700.00 and $135,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a fraud manager do?

A Fraud Manager oversees fraud prevention, detection, and investigation efforts within an organization. They analyze transactions, implement fraud detection systems, and develop strategies to minimize financial losses. Additionally, they collaborate with law enforcement, regulatory bodies, and internal teams to ensure compliance and risk mitigation. Their role is crucial in protecting a company's assets and maintaining customer trust.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a fraud manager?

To thrive as a Fraud Manager, you need a strong background in data analysis, risk management, and knowledge of financial regulations, typically supported by a bachelor's degree in finance, business, or a related field. Familiarity with fraud detection software, data analytics tools, and certifications such as Certified Fraud Examiner (CFE) are highly valued. Strong problem-solving, leadership, and communication skills help in managing teams and coordinating investigations. These competencies are crucial to effectively detect, prevent, and respond to fraudulent activities within an organization.

What are some typical challenges faced by fraud managers in their daily work?

Fraud Managers often encounter challenges such as adapting to evolving fraud tactics, balancing thorough investigations with timely responses, and managing large volumes of alerts or suspicious activity. Staying current with regulatory changes and emerging financial crime trends is essential, as is collaborating with cross-functional teams including IT, compliance, and legal departments. These demands require a proactive approach and continuous professional development to ensure ongoing protection of the organization’s assets. Overcoming these challenges is both demanding and rewarding, offering opportunities for career advancement and recognition.

E-Commerce Fraud Manager

Jdgroupnam

Indianapolis, IN

Full-time

Posted 13 days ago


Job description

OPEN TO REMOTE

The E-Commerce Fraud Manager supports the Profit & Asset Protection team to minimize ecommerce fraud and chargebacks. This role requires a strategic leader who is innovative for the future of the fast-paced payments industry and stays on the absolute forefront of new, complex fraud models. Some of the main duties include:

  • Develops dashboards and KPI reporting for multiple cross functional areas of the business, including but not limited to merchandising, supply chain, finance, and e-commerce.

  • Analyzes both internal and external payment/fraud performance on a daily, weekly and monthly basis and compares to service level agreements.

  • Makes recommendations to cross-functional business groups to prevent fraud and decrease loss to the company. Champions crucial cross-functional partnerships not only with internal business units but also with other retailers to share threat intelligence, combat fraud rings, and established industry best practices.

  • Performs in-depth analysis to show the success of payments versus the incidence of chargebacks with current state and potential state solutions. Goal is to maximize sales while minimizing chargebacks.

  • Proposes enhancements to existing proprietary and third party algorithms and analytics processes, develops prototypes, and conducts comparative performance studies.

  • Anticipates and mitigates fraud trends impacting high-demand products in the competitive reseller market, such as automated bots during limited release events, inventory abuse, and Buy Online, Pick-up In-Store (BOPIS) fraud.

  • Present a variety of technical topics to both technical and non-technical business partners.

  • Builds constructive and effective relationships with a broad and diverse group of business partners

  • Works in tandem with the Loyalty Team to reduce fraud.

  • Additional projects and duties as required.
